Ingredients

  • 8 oz spaghetti
  • 1 lb ground beef or turkey
  • 1 jar (24 oz) marinara sauce
  • 1 cup ricotta cheese
  • 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tsp Italian seasoning
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ish

Servings and Cooking Time

This recipe serves 4 people. Preparation time is approximately 15 minutes, and cooking time is 30 minutes.

Nutritional Value

Based on a serving size of 1/4 of the dish, the nutritional value per serving includes approximately 450 calories, 25g protein, 30g carbohydrates, and 25g fat. This is for one person.

Step-by-Step Cooking Process

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Cook the spaghetti according to package instructions; drain and set aside.
  3. In a skillet, brown the ground beef or turkey over medium heat.
  4. Add the marinara sauce to the cooked meat and simmer for 5 minutes.
  5. In a large bowl, mix the cooked spaghetti with the meat sauce.
  6. In another bowl, combine ricotta cheese,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
  7. Spread half of the spaghetti mixture in a baking dish.
  8. Layer the ricotta mixture on top of the spaghetti.
  9. Add the remaining spaghetti on top of the ricotta layer.
  10. S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the top.
  11.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es until the cheese is bubbly and golden.
  12. Remove from the oven and let cool for a few minutes before serving.

Alternative Ingredients

You can easily substitute ground beef with ground chicken or a plant-based alternative for a healthier option. For a lighter version, use whole wheat spaghetti or zucchini noodles. Additionally, swap ricotta for cottage cheese if desired.

Serving and Pairings

This baked spaghetti pairs wonderfully with a fresh green salad, garlic bread, or steamed vegetables. A glass of red wine or sparkling water adds a nice touch to the meal.

Storage and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ply microwave or bake until warmed through. This dish can also be frozen for up to 2 months; thaw in the refrigerator before reheating.

FAQs

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the dish in advance and store it in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before baking. Just make sure to cover it tightly to prevent drying out.

Can I use gluten-free pasta?

Absolutely! Gluten-free pasta works well in this recipe. Just be sure to follow the cooking instructions on the package for best results.

What can I add for more flavor?

Consider adding spices like red pepper flakes for heat or fresh herbs like basil and oregano for additional flavor complexity.

Can I use different types of cheese?

Yes, feel free to mix and match your favorite cheeses! Cheddar, provolone, or even a blend can add unique flavors.

How do I know when the spaghetti is done baking?

The dish is ready when the cheese is melted and bubbly, and the edges start to turn golden brown. A toothpick inserted in the middle should come out hot.
